AutoIndex is a PHP script that makes a table that lists the files in a directory, and lets users access the files and subdirectories.
It includes searching, icons for each file type, an admin panel, uploads, access logging, file descriptions, and more.

This project was originally created to allow Technical Support personnel to troubleshoot problems with customers logging into their e-mail.
It was written to work with VPOPMail when the VLOG, database logging feature, is turned ON.

phpAwStats is written in PHP5 and is meant to parse AWStats logfiles and store them in a database for simplified reading and displaying.
The main goal is to display the stats customized using templates on your webpage or on customer interfaces.
